1、在线教务辅导网: http:/ 更多课程配套课件资源请访问在线教务辅导网2018/5/5 1第 10章 数 -模 /模 -数转换及其接口在计算机控制和检测系统中,需要输入的自然界的模拟量必须首先转换为数字量(称为模 -数转换或 A/D转换),然后输入给计算机;而计算机输出的数字量(控制信号),需要转换为模拟量(称为数 -模转换或 D/A转换),以实现对外部执行部件的模拟量控制。A/D和 D/A转换器是自动化系统和数字测量技术中的重要部件,对于应用系统的设计者,只需按照设计要求合理地选用商品化的 A/D、 D/A转换器,了解它们的功能和接口方法并正确地使用。2018/5/5 2 10.1 D/A
2、转换器 D/A转换器在测控系统中将计算机输出的数字量控制信号转换成模拟信号,用于驱动外部执行机构。 1 D/A转换器的主要参数 ( 1)分辨率:指数字量最低有效位( LSB)对应的模拟值。 D/A能够转换的二进制的位数越多,分辨率也越高,一般为 8位、 10位、 12位等。 若 N位 D/A转换器,则分辨率为 : 输出电压量程 /2N 2018/5/5 3 例如: 8位 D/A转换器,若转换后的电压相应为 0 5V,则它能输出可分辨的最小电压为: ( 5 0) /25619.53mV ( 2)转换时间:是指 D/A转换器完成一次转换所需的时间 ( 3)线性度:表示 D/A转换模拟输出偏离理想输
3、出的最大值。 ( 4)输出电平:电压一般在 5 10V之间, ( 5)转换精度:表明 D/A转换的精确程度,可分为绝对精度和相对精度。2018/5/5 4 2. 8位集成 D/A转换器 -DAC0832 (1) DAC0832的内部结构 DAC0832是双列直插式单片 8位 D/A转换器。转换速度为 1s,可直接与微机接口。 DAC0832内部结构 2018/5/5 5(2)DAC0832引脚 : 2018/5/5 6 数据输入端 D0 D7: 8位,连接 CPU数据总线。 ILE:数据允许锁存信号,高电平有效,输入; :片选信号(输入寄存器选择信号)、低电平有效、输入; :数据传送信号、低电
4、平有效、输入,该信号与 逻辑与作为 DAC寄存器工作的控制信号。 : DAC寄存器的写选通信号、低电平有效、输入; :输入寄存器写选通信号、低电平有效、输入。2018/5/5 7 ( 3) DAC0832三种工作方式 1)直通方式 在直通方式下, DAC0832的两个寄存器一直处于直通状态。 2)单缓冲方式 在单缓冲方式下, DAC0832的两个寄存器中的一个工作在直通状态,另一个工作在受控状态,这种方式适用于只有一路模拟输出或多路模拟量不需要同步输出的系统。2018/5/5 8 3)双缓冲方式 : 在双缓冲方式下,输入寄存器和 DAC寄存器都工作在受控状态。 CPU需要分别对两个寄存器各执行一次写入操作,才能完成 D/A转换。即 CPU首先将输入数字量写入输入寄存器,然后将输入寄存器的内容写入 DAC寄存器。 该方式适用于需要多个 DAC0832转换器同时使用的系统。2018/5/5 9 ( 4) DAC0832应用接口 见教材图 10-6 DAC0832工作于单缓冲器方式单极性输出接口2018/5/5 10